The winners of the 2021 Australian Open will earn $1.3 million less than last year – Wide World of Sports
‘Tougher and tougher for players to make a living’

The winners of this year’s Australian Open will receive a pay cheque sliced by more than $1.3 million as tournament organisers redistribute money to look after the sport’s more modest performers.
Sofia Kenin and Novak Djokovic won $4.12 million for their 2020 AO triumphs but the major prize drops to $2.75 million this year.
AO boss Craig Tiley has confirmed that the overall prizemoney pool will remain intact while Tennis Australia has lobbied for better spoils for the ‘battlers.’
